I know NOS makes it, I think ZEX makes it, you really don't need major modifications for a 50 shot, the stock rail and injectors are fine, if anything, get a pressure regulator and maybe a fuel pump, then you'll be ready for boost later.

NOS isn't as cheap as you might think though. Yeah the kit is only 500-600, but the Nitrous is not cheap. Are you ready to spend 40-50 a week on refills?
